Elexis: Das führende OpenSource-Arztpraxisprogamm
im deutschsprachigen Raum
Java doc für Elexis version 2.1.7.dev vom 01.09.2013

ch.unibe.iam.scg.archie.controller
Class ChartModelManager

java.lang.Object
  extended by ch.unibe.iam.scg.archie.controller.ChartModelManager

public class ChartModelManager
extends java.lang.Object

Manages Chart Models.

$Id$


Method Summary
 void clean()
          Removes all saved chart models.
 ChartModel getBarChartModel()
           
static ChartModelManager getInstance()
          Returns an instance of this chart model manager.
 ChartModel getPieChartModel()
           
 boolean hasBarChartModel()
           
 boolean hasChartModel(int type)
           
 boolean hasPieChartModel()
           
 void setBarChartModel(ChartModel barChartModel)
           
 void setChartModel(ChartModel chartModel)
           
 void setPieChartModel(ChartModel pieChartModel)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getInstance

public static ChartModelManager getInstance()
Returns an instance of this chart model manager.

Returns:
An instance of this chart model manager.

getBarChartModel

public ChartModel getBarChartModel()
Returns:
the barChartModel

setBarChartModel

public void setBarChartModel(ChartModel barChartModel)
Parameters:
barChartModel - the barChartModel to set

setChartModel

public void setChartModel(ChartModel chartModel)
Parameters:
chartModel -

getPieChartModel

public ChartModel getPieChartModel()
Returns:
the pieChartModel

setPieChartModel

public void setPieChartModel(ChartModel pieChartModel)
Parameters:
pieChartModel - the pieChartModel to set

hasChartModel

public boolean hasChartModel(int type)
Parameters:
type -
Returns:
whether we have a model or not.

hasPieChartModel

public boolean hasPieChartModel()
Returns:
whether we have a PieChartModel or not.

hasBarChartModel

public boolean hasBarChartModel()
Returns:
whether we have a BarChartModel or not.

clean

public void clean()
Removes all saved chart models.


Elexis: Das führende OpenSource-Arztpraxisprogamm
im deutschsprachigen Raum
Java doc für Elexis version 2.1.7.dev vom 01.09.2013